About the product

Description

A broad-spectrum, bactericidal antibiotic of the fluoroquinolone drug class that treats bacterial infections. (Podder & Sadiq, 2020) A valuable antimicrobial agent that has high levels of susceptibility among Gram-negative, Gram-positive including penicillin-resistant strains of Streptococcus pneumonia and atypical pathogens. (Antoni Torres, 2012) More active against gram-positive pathogens than ciprofloxacin. (Miriam Hurst, 2002) As effective as gatifloxacin, clarithromycin, azithromycin or amoxicillin/clavulanic acid in patients with mild to severe community-acquired pneumonia. (Miriam Hurst H. M., 2002) An effective therapy as intravenous imipenem/cilastatin in suspected bacteraemia patients. (Miriam Hurst H. M., 2002) A therapeutic regimen in patients with uncomplicated skin and skin structure infections, and complicated urinary tract infections. (Miriam Hurst H. M., 2002) Achieves 64.7% clinical success rate as compared with 41.2% with comparator treatment (imipenem/cilastatin followed by ciprofloxacin) in patients diagnosed with nosocomial pneumonia. (Alan M Tennenberg, 2006) Exhibits good clinical and microbiological efficacy for use in lower respiratory tract infections that are caused by Streptococcus pneumoniae. (Guoying Cao, 2020) Demonstrates antibacterial efficacy against a variety of infections, including upper and lower respiratory tract, genitourinary, obstetric, gynecological, and skin and soft tissues. (R Davis, 1994) An attractive option for the treatment of at-risk patients with serious respiratory tract infections including community-acquired pneumonia and acute exacerbations of chronic bronchitis. (Rafael Cantón, 2006)

Side Effects

Headache, Dizziness, Nausea, Constipation, Diarrhea

Indication

Urinary tract infection , Pneumonia , Skin and Skin Structure Infection , Acute Pyelonephritis , Acute Bacterial Exacerbation of Chronic Bronchitis , Acute Bacterial Sinusitis
